Find LCM of 586,274,856,360,600 with Prime Factorization
2 | 586, 274, 856, 360, 600 |
2 | 293, 137, 428, 180, 300 |
2 | 293, 137, 214, 90, 150 |
3 | 293, 137, 107, 45, 75 |
5 | 293, 137, 107, 15, 25 |
293, 137, 107, 3, 5 |
Multiply the prime numbers at the bottom and the left side.
2 x 2 x 2 x 3 x 5 x 293 x 137 x 107 x 3 x 5 = 7731156600
Therefore, the lowest common multiple of 586,274,856,360,600 is 7731156600.
